What initiatives, policies, and technologies can significantly reduce greenhouse gas emissions from the buildings sector?
The Intergovernmental Panel on Climate Change estimates that buildings will account for over 25 percent of global greenhouse gas emissions in 2030, and that nearly half of these emissions can be avoided at modest cost. This contest seeks proposals on how emissions from new or existing buildings can be significantly reduced, with a focus on increasing energy efficiency.
